I/O Configuration

Selectable current output range
You will need to define the current loop scale and define a source for an
analogue output signal. For a spectral pyrometer the sources for ana-
logue output Ao1 is
-
Spectral channel 1
In the normal operating mode, Spectral channel 1 will be shown on
the display.
The second analogue output Ao2 offers additional the following option:
-
Spectral channel 1 temperature before Min/Max memory
-
Inner device temperature
Configure the scale of each of the two analogue outputs separately. De-
fine the temperature span by adjusting the upper and lower limits of the
measuring range. Select either 0 – 20 mA or 4 – 20 mA as the current
output range. The temperature to current conversion is linear.
The desired current output range of either 0 – 20 mA or 4 – 20 mA can
be configured as an absolute setting. Alternatively, the current range can
be coupled to the specific voltages of Switching Output 1 or 2.
-
0 V -> 0—20 mA
-
24 V -> 4—20 mA
